Answers:
systemctl |grep Modem # (may show ModemManger.service)
systemctl [stop|start|enable|disable] ModemManager.service
这使UML-295调制解调器无法由ModemManger管理,而后者又通过CentOS 7 上的http://mbb.vzw.com启用了Web控制。
通过以下方式禁用后检查:
systemctl list-dependencies multi-user.target |grep Modem
sudo systemctl disable ModemManager
这看起来工作正常:
sudo mv /usr/share/dbus-1/system-services/org.freedesktop.ModemManager.service /usr/share/dbus-1/system-services/org.freedesktop.ModemManager.service.disabled
相反,这是行不通的(不知道y):
"echo manual | sudo tee -a /etc/init/modemmanager.override"
ubuntu 14.04
和开始Linux Mint 17.3
,它是ModemManager1
; 我现在也习惯了sudo ugo-x /usr/sbin/ModemManager
。
最简单的方法是:
sudo apt-get purge modemmanager
在12.04 LTS中可以正常工作。我的系统中没有任何东西依赖于modemmanager。
或者,您可以在Ubuntu软件中心中搜索“ modemmanager”并将其从那里删除(标题为“用于管理调制解调器的D-Bus服务”)。
sudo apt-get install modemmanager
,不是吗?
如果是SysV初始化样式的符号链接
update-rc.d [-n] [-f] base_name remove
如果是按用户(X11会话),请检查以下文件夹和远程对应的文件:
~/.config/autostart
/etc/xdg/autostart
systemctl status ModemManager.service
表明,调制解调器经理是罪魁祸首:Could not grab port (tty/ttyACM0): 'Cannot add port 'tty/ttyACM0', unhandled serial type'